JOB SEARCH TIPS<br />

Here are some handy tips to keep in mind when looking for employment.<br />

Networking<br />

• Tell everyoneyou know that you are looking for work -<br />

friends, relatives, neighbours, former co-workers and<br />

employers, etc.. These people may know <strong>of</strong> job leads.<br />

• Visit job fairs. Go dressed for an interview and bring copies <strong>of</strong><br />

your résumé.<br />

• Register with personnel agencies.<br />

Job Searching<br />

• Use all available resources. The <strong>County</strong> <strong>of</strong> <strong>Wellington</strong> has a<br />

resource centre which has free services including books on job<br />

hunting, fax and Internet use, newspapers and job postings.<br />

• Look beyond newspapers. Try community bulletin boards at<br />

your children’s school, the local community college, or your<br />

place <strong>of</strong> worship.<br />

• Go online. Many job opportunities are listed on the Internet.<br />

• Research companies you are interested in, even if they are not<br />

hiring. Send them your résumé and let them know you are<br />

looking.<br />

• Volunteer your time. If you find you lack the experience needed<br />

for the jobs you are looking for, learn new skills by volunteering<br />

in theCommunity Placement Program.<br />
